🕰 Watch Overview: Patek Philippe Nautilus (Gold, White Dial)
Key Features
Case Material: Likely 18k yellow or rose gold
Dial: White, with horizontal embossing — a signature Nautilus design element
Date Window: Positioned at 3 o'clock
Bezel: Rounded octagonal — a hallmark of Gérald Genta’s design
Bracelet: Integrated gold bracelet, matching the case
Water Resistance: 120 meters (remarkable for a luxury sports watch)
Movement: Self-winding mechanical movement (often the Caliber 26‑330 S C in modern references)
Display: Hours, minutes, central seconds, and date
🧭 History and Design
Introduced: 1976, designed by Gérald Genta
Inspiration: Ship's porthole — seen in the case construction and bezel shape
Purpose: Blend of sporty robustness and elegant refinement
Notable Reference: 5711/1R-001 (rose gold with white dial — a possible match
💎 Why It’s So Valuable
Limited Production: Patek Philippe produces roughly 60,000 watches per year, across all models. Nautilus models represent only a fraction of that.
Craftsmanship: Hand-finished movements, Geneva Seal certification, and meticulous quality control
Exclusivity: Waitlists for popular references can stretch for years
Resale Value: Due to demand exceeding supply, many Nautilus models appreciate significantly in value
